最近在启动一个项目需要用到数据库,已有备份数据,却不知如何恢复数据。 查看了一下mongoDB菜鸟驿站(http://www.runoob.com/mongodb/mongodb-mongodump-mongorestore.html),没有仔细看,操作了一会也没操作出来。 后面反复看一下教程 ...
将被回滚的mongodb设置成primary db.copyDatabase rollback , e cloud base , . . . : , , 非auth方式,将回滚数据库复制到目标数据库 db.e cloud base.ccenterRecord. T . .find . forEach function i db.ccenter.insert i 逐个表执行命令,将回滚数据备份表的数 ...
2020-05-29 09:43 0 532 推荐指数:
最近在启动一个项目需要用到数据库,已有备份数据,却不知如何恢复数据。 查看了一下mongoDB菜鸟驿站(http://www.runoob.com/mongodb/mongodb-mongodump-mongorestore.html),没有仔细看,操作了一会也没操作出来。 后面反复看一下教程 ...
复制(副本集) 什么是复制 复制提供了数据的冗余备份,并在多个服务器上存储数据副本,提高了数据的可用性,并可以保证数据的安全性 复制还允许从硬件故障和服务中断中恢复数据 为什么要复制 数据备份 数据灾难恢复 读写分离 高(24* 7)数据可用性 无宕机 ...
一、MongoDB副本集(repl set)介绍 早起版本使用master-slave,一主一从和MySQL类似,但slave在此架构中为只读,当主库宕机后,从库不能自动切换为主; 目前已经淘汰了master-slave模式,改为副本集,这种模式下有一个主(primary),和多个 ...
副本集的搭建,请见 CENTOS6.5 虚拟机MONGODB创建副本集 接下来将简单说明下副本集之间的数据同步。 1、首先,进入primary节点 MOGO_PATH/bin/mongo -port 37017 在test collection中添加数据 2、查看 ...
在MongoDB副本集的测试中发现了一个丢数据的案例。 1. 概要描述 测试场景为:一主一从一验证 测试案例 step1 :关闭从副本; step 2 ;向主副本中插入那条数据; step 3 :关闭主副本; step 4 :开启辅助副本,此副本升级为主副本,这是后会看到新 ...
(一)MongoDB恢复概述 对于任何数据库,如果要将数据库恢复到过去的任意时间点,否需要有过去某个时间点的全备+全备之后的重做日志。 接下来根据瑞丽航空的情况进行概述: 全备:每天晚上都会进行备份; 重做日志备份:MongoDB只有开启主从复制或者副本集时才会开启重做日志,主从复制存放在 ...
复制的重要性不再多说,其主要就是提供数据保护,数据高可用和灾难恢复。 复制是跨多个mongodb服务器分布和维护的方法。mongodb可以把数据从一个节点复制到其他节点并在修改时进行同步。 mongodb的复制有两种方式: 副本集复制和主从架构复制。这两种方法类似,主节点接收所有的写请求 ...
需要用到mongodb的时候单个实例肯定是不行的,挂了怎么办,那然后呢,跟mysql一样搞主从备份吗,是可以的mongodb这么弄,不过官网已经不推荐了这么干了,推荐使用副本集的模式,然后数据再大一点到TB级别就需要使用分片节点模式了,不过没那么大的数据没用到过,不管它。副本集就是每个都是副本 ...